SEC Tweaks Filing Manual for Smoother Business Paperwork
Published Date: 1/30/2025
Rule
Summary
The SEC is updating the EDGAR Filer Manual to make filing financial documents easier and clearer for companies. These changes affect anyone who submits reports through EDGAR, with new rules kicking in on December 16, 2024. No big costs are expected, but filers should get ready for smoother, more efficient reporting.
Analyzed Economic Effects
1 provisions identified: 1 benefits, 0 costs, 0 mixed.
EDGAR Filer Manual Update
The Securities and Exchange Commission adopted amendments to Volume II of the EDGAR Filer Manual to make submitting financial reports easier and clearer. EDGAR Release 24.4 will be deployed on December 16, 2024; the Commission states no big costs are expected but filers should prepare for the changes.
